WebWorking principle of ion exchange water treatment system. The device apply strong acid cation resin to replace calcium and magnesium ions in raw water, and then the water after treatment of softening and desalting can be directly used as the make-up water of steam boiler. The chemical reaction is as follows: 2RNa+Ca2+ (Mg2)=R2Ca (Mg)+2Na+. Web16 mrt. 2024 · When reading ion exchange resin product data sheets, you will typically see that the specific flow rate in water treatment should be between 5 and 50 bed volumes per hour (m 3 /h per m 3 of resin). At lower flow rates, hydraulic distribution in the resin bed may be poor, and at higher flow rates, kinetic effects may affect the speed of exchange, … Web22 sep. 2024 · Installation costs typically range between 15–40% of the project cost, depending on the degree of prepackaging and amount of site civil work needed.
